Ju 88 crash, London mission, 24./25.3.44

Hello colleagues,

for a family research I appreciate any detail on the loss of the following a/c:

Ju 88 WNr. 300032, II./KG 54, B3+HP
crew: Lt.Hahn/Uffz Kaenders/Uffz Rebotzki/Uffz Sieben all MIA

I am particularly interested in the reason for the loss (night fighter, flak, break-down, accident?) and the approx. location, maybe someone has read the Kriegstagebuch or similar documents on KG 54?

Re: Ju 88 crash, London mission, 24./25.3.44

It is likely this aircraft fell to an RAF night fighter over the English Channel it is not shown as crashing in the UK. Possibly a Mosquito of 85 Sqd shot this aircraft down there were two possible claims. As far as I know there are no reports of bodies from this crew being recovered from the sea. It is unfortunately not possible to be more specific with such losses over the sea,

Re: Ju 88 crash, London mission, 24./25.3.44

Hello ,

I don't know if it could help , but I have two police reports about crashes in Normandy that night :
- at 23.30 a plane crashed at Thiedeville ( between Dieppe and Rouen ) and burned on the ground with its incendiaries . Fate of crew unknown.
- at 0.30 in a field at St Leonard ( Fecamp ) , crater 4m wide 2m deep , several explosions and many incendiaries around. No mention about fate of crew too.

Sorry I have no idea about type of airplane .

Re: Ju 88 crash, London mission, 24./25.3.44

As far as could see KG2 lost two Do217's over France unfortunately the NVM's are not complete. The crew were killed in the crash of U5+IS, while the pilot was killed and the other three baled out of U5+KS which crashed at 2338hrs following engine trouble. Additionally a Me410 of 2/KG51 crashed at Chavigny with both crewmen killed. Other known losses were - KG2 lost a Ju188 and two more Do217's, KG6 lost three Ju88's over England, KG30 lost one Ju88 missing one at Merzhausen and one over Belgium, KG54 had two Ju88's missing, KG66 lost one JU88S 40km south of Brighton and another 6km south of Brighton with one crewman rescued POW, and a He177 was damaged in an emergency landing with two crewmen injured.
